Назад | Перейти на главную страницу

Время на сервере увеличено на 7 месяцев

CentOS 5.x

Мой сервер CentOS, похоже, продвинулся вперед на 7 месяцев. Не знаю, как и почему. Есть ли в CentOS какие-либо журналы, которые могут дать здесь больше информации?

К сожалению, ntpd не работал. С тех пор я настроил / включил его, и время / дата были исправлены.

-M

С другой стороны, если это виртуальная, а не физическая машина, могут быть некоторые проблемы, связанные с хост-машиной. У VMWare есть технический документ по этому поводу. Я знаю, что лично сталкивался с этим, когда у меня был перегруженный гость, у которого не хватало оперативной памяти. Это закончилось потерей времени и ужасным рассинхронизацией.

Я хорошо понимаю, что вы специально не упомянули виртуализацию, но это может быть полезно для всех, кто сталкивается с этим вопросом.


- Кристофер Карел

Это наиболее явная проблема с батареей часов материнской платы. Если вы размещаете его самостоятельно, просто выключите компьютер, отключите его от источника питания; извлеките аккумулятор и проверьте его с помощью средства проверки аккумулятора. Если он мертв, вы можете легко заменить его; Если нет, замените его, убедившись, что он надежно подключен и не ослаблен. Затем при загрузке сбросьте время CMOS на текущее время / дату.

Однако, если вы не размещаете сервер, обратитесь к своим хостам.

Ты можешь использовать hwclock -r для чтения времени, хранящегося в NVRAM. (Я все еще люблю называть это CMOS, неправильно это или нет.) Скорее всего, вы перезагрузились и время там выставлено неправильно.

Если батарея вашей материнской платы разряжена, вы выключаетесь на 7 часов и загружаетесь обратно; вы потеряете это время.

В противном случае это потенциально может быть вызвано сдвигом по времени из-за умирающей батареи материнской платы.